Actually tankers are extremely difficult to sink. Their cargo is generally neutral to bouyant. Enviro weenies have ensured that they are mostly double hulled. They have the ability to transfer significant amounts of cargo/ballast quickly. They have good fire suppression systems. Their vast bulk ensures that massive amounts of damage must be done using repeat attacks. (Very unhealthy for the enemies crews to fire that second salvo) Few if any would be sunk or significantly damaged (ie cargo lost, since the vessel can be towed clear if neccesary.) I saw mention of the insurance issue. IIRC the premiums were high but not prohibitively so once we began escorting tankers.
